TD Bank Group is a Canadian bank founded in 1855 whose modern form dates from the 1955 merger of the Bank of Toronto and the Dominion Bank. It runs one of the two largest retail banking networks in Canada, an unusually large American retail franchise built along the east coast under the TD Bank brand, a wholesale bank through TD Securities and a direct investing business, and it held a substantial stake in Charles Schwab for several years. Headquartered in Toronto and listed in Toronto and New York, it has spent recent years rebuilding its anti-money-laundering controls after United States regulatory penalties.

About the Role

As an Auto Claims Advisor, you will play a critical role in supporting customers immediately following an accident. You will guide them through the claims process with empathy, professionalism, and expertise - ensuring they feel informed, supported, and confident every step of the way.

Key Responsibilities

Customer Experience (Legendary Service)

  • Deliver a customer-first experience through empathy, active listening, and clear communication

  • Provide timely updates and guidance, ensuring customers feel supported during the claims process

  • Welcome and assist customers onsite, creating a professional and reassuring environment

Execution & Claim Management

  • Manage claims end-to-end, including coordinating towing, appraisals, repairs, and rentals

  • Maintain a high-volume caseload while ensuring accuracy, quality, and timely resolution

  • Review and reconcile repair estimates to support fair and appropriate settlements

  • Maintain detailed and accurate claims documentation

Analytical Thinking & Risk Management

  • Gather, assess, and validate information from multiple sources to support claim decisions

  • Apply policy knowledge to explain coverage and determine outcomes aligned with guidelines

  • Identify discrepancies and ensure claims are handled in accordance with regulatory and risk standards

Collaboration & Teamwork

  • Partner with internal stakeholders and external vendors (e.g., repair shops, rental providers) to deliver seamless service

  • Contribute to team performance by supporting operational goals and maintaining productivity metrics

Growth & Continuous Improvement

  • Develop expertise in claims handling, coverage, and investigation practices

  • Contribute to process improvements and support a culture of continuous learning

  • Pursue professional development, including CIP designation (asset)
